Pasco residents came together Saturday for the Heritage Park Foundation's second Traditions on the Green celebration in Land O' Lakes.
Music, dancing, games and Santa on a Harley were highlights of the free community holiday celebration at the Land O' Lakes Community Center, 5401 Land O' Lakes Blvd.
"It's important for the community to have central traditions going on," said Sandy Graves, president of the Heritage Park Foundation. "We want Land O' Lakes to keep its community feel."
Traditions on the Green also was a collection site for a canned food drive. All donations will go to the Joining Hands Mission, a branch of Metropolitan Ministries, in Holiday.
Traditions on the Green kicked off with a free breakfast with Santa.
